首页 > TAG信息列表 > MysqlData
linux系统mysql数据库目录迁移
1、关闭mysql sudo /etc/init.d/mysql stop或 systemctl stop mysql 2、移动数据存储位置 mv /var/lib/mysql/* /media/mysqldata 3、修改my.cnf配置文件 datadir=/media/mysqldata socket=/media/mysqldata/mysql.sock 4、创建连接并赋予权限 ln -s /mdocker安装mysql
1.查看需要安装的镜像版本 https://registry.hub.docker.com/_/mysql?tab=tags 2.选择自己需要的版本号 3.在安装好docker的linux服务器中安装mysql (1)拉取最新版本mysql docker pull mysql (1.1)拉取指定版本的mysql docker pull mysql:5.7 (2)拉取结束,查看本地是否存在mysqdocker安装mysql
访问 MySQL 镜像库地址 拉取mysql5.7版本 docker pull mysql:5.7 如果需要最新版本 docker pull mysql:latest 等待下载 下载完成后查看镜像 docker images 启动docker容器 docker run -d --name mysql5.7 -p 3306:3306 -e MYSQL_ROOT_PASSWORD=123456 mysql:5.7 docker rLinux定时备份数据库,通过使用Shell脚本自动备份数据库
在Linux环境下,使用Shell脚本自动备份数据库,需要用到 crontab 定时任务,以下是使用 mysqldump 方式对数据库备份 1、新建shell脚本,这里命名为 dbbackup.sh /usr/bin/mysqldump -u用户名 -p密码 -h 数据库IP -R --opt 要备份的数据库名 |gzip > /backup/mysqldata/`date +%Y-%Windows下更改MySQL 数据库文件存放位置
更改默认的mysql数据库目录 将 C:\Documents and Settings\All Users\Application Data\MySQL\MySQL Server 5.1\data 改到 D:\MysqlData 1. 建立文件夹 D:\MysqlData 2. 停止 mysql 服务,将 "C:\Documents and Settings\All Users\Application Data\MySQL\MySQL Server 5.1\data&linux服务器mysql数据库目录迁移
1、关闭mysql(一般启动关闭命令为前者) service mysql stop 或 systemctl stop mysqld.service 2、移动数据存储位置 mv /var/lib/mysql/* /test/mysqldata 3、修改my.cnf配置文件 datadir=/test/mysqldata socket=/test/mysqldata/mysql.sock 4、创建连接并赋予MySQL安装
MySQL安装 1> 关闭防火墙和selinux 关闭防火墙 1 service iptables stop 2 chkconfig --level 345 iptables off 关闭selinux 1 setenforce 0 2 cat /etc/SELINUX/config | grep selinux= 查看结果是否为selinux=disabled 2>创建MySQL用户 1 groupadd -g 54330 mys容器网络(九)创建 Rex-Ray volume【71】
(四)创建 Rex-Ray volume 前面我们安装部署了 Rex-Ray,并且成功配置 VirtualBox backend,今天演示如何创建和使用 Rex-Ray volume。 在 docker1 或 docker2 上执行如下命令创建 volume: docker volume create --driver rexray --name=mysqldata --opt=size=2 volume mysqldata 创容器网络(九)跨主机使用 Rex-Ray volume【72】
(五)跨主机使用 Rex-Ray volume 上一节我们在 docker1 上的 MySQL 容器中使用了 Rex-Ray volume mysqldata,更新了数据库。现在容器已经删除,今天将演示在 docker2 中重新使用这个卷。 在 dokcer2 上执行如下命令,启动 MySQL 容器: docker run --name mydb_on_docker2 -v mysqldata:/vaCentOS7下如何修改mysql的数据目录
因当前根目录较小,后来又新挂载一个硬盘/data,现需将mysql数据目录更换到/data下 1、停止mysqld服务:systemctl stop mysqld 2、查看mysql数据库的原数据目录:/raiddisk/mysqldata vim /etc/my.cnf 3、建立目标数据目录:mkdir -p /data/mysqldata,并将原数据目录/raiddisk/mysqldata下my.cnf文件详解
#客户端设置,即客户端默认的连接参数 [client] #默认连接端口 port = 3306 #用于本地连接的socket套接字 socket = /data/mysqldata/3306/mysql.sock #编码 default-character-set = utf8mb4 #服务端基本设置 [mysqld] #MySQL监听端口 port = 33mysql常用命令
1.使用SHOW语句 找出在数据库服务器上存在什么数据库(前提:当前用户拥有查询权限) 1 mysql>SHOW DATABASES; 2.创建一个数据库MYSQLDATA mysql>CREATE DATABASE MYSQLDATA; 3.选择你创建的数据库 mysql>USE MYSQLDATA; 4.查看当前数据库中存在什么表 mysql>SHOW TABLES; 5.